Default PAN and Fox advocacy groups merge

Hi all,
I haven't been here in ages, but I wanted everyone to know that the old advocacy group for legislative issues ( PARKINSON'S Action Network) and the michael J. fox organization have merge. Many of the old PAN volunteers are assuming their same duties. Your voices are needed for legislative issues so just know that the volunteers are now working with Fox rather than alone.
